Handover — badge migration, Pellworth site. Old Keystone readers die Friday; new Lattice readers go live same day. Expect badge failures all morning. Escalations go to the migration channel, not the main queue. Spare temp fobs are in drawer three, logged per issue. Until everyone's re-enrolled, side doors need manual entry. Use the override code below for those doors.

staff pass of kawip-hawef = bdg-QLP-2

- [ ] **Step 7: Breaker override escrow.** After sealing the signing keys for the Tallgrove upstream API circuit breaker, confirm the support team can force the breaker open during a full outage. The override bundle lives in the sealed escrow drawer and is useless without its unlock phrase. Two ceremony witnesses must initial this step before proceeding. The escrow bundle is decrypted with the recovery passphrase that follows.

vault phrase of kahip-kahop = holath-quenmir

## Environment Variables — Quillhorn Broker Upgrade

Hey release crew: the 5.x broker reads config from `.env.broker` now, not the old YAML. Make sure `BROKER_CLUSTER_NAME=quillhorn-prod` and `BROKER_MAX_INFLIGHT=500` are set before cutover, or consumers will reconnect-loop. TLS is mandatory in 5.x, and the broker won't boot without its access credential, which goes on the next line.

env line for fafof-fahag: LEDGER_TOKEN5=f8790

## Alert: Read-Replica Lag — Cartwheel DB

Fires when replication lag on the Cartwheel read replicas exceeds 45 seconds for 5 minutes. Impact: stale reads on the storefront; checkout is unaffected. Do not proceed with a release while this alert is active. Check the Bramblehost replication dashboard first; most incidents self-resolve within ten minutes. If lag persists past 20 minutes, notify the data platform team.

escalation mailbox, bafog-fafog: ulador@paliqlabs.internal

## Onboarding: Farebranch Rules Engine

Plugin authors integrate with Farebranch by registering fee rules against the evaluation API. Rules are sandboxed; they cannot perform network calls directly. All rate-table lookups go through the host, which validates your plugin manifest at load time. Your local env file must include the signing credential the host uses to verify manifests, set on the next line.

secret setting of bajef-fajof: COURIER_KEY3=76c